CPC votes to request additional funding for Robertson Trail Bridge
Community Preservation Committee · Meeting of February 4, 2026
Upton CPC unanimously votes $35,000 additional for Robertson Trail Bridge. The Community Preservation Committee approved the additional funding request at its February 4 remote meeting after the bridge project faced cost overruns; the original contractor estimate came in $40,000 below the final bid. Chair Mike Penko had proposed seeking $60,000 from the 2026 Annual Town Meeting, but the committee voted to request $35,000.
The committee also unanimously approved $25,000 in administrative costs for fiscal year 2026. Member Katherine Robertson raised questions about whether a trail easement could eliminate the bridge's necessity entirely.
